Planning Your Budget and Component Selection
Before diving into the specifics, it's crucial to outline a budget and prioritize components. A smart approach is to allocate more funds to the most performance-critical parts, such as the graphics card and processor, while opting for more economical choices for less impactful components like the case and storage (initially).
Key Components to Consider
- CPU (Central Processing Unit): The brain of your PC, responsible for processing instructions and running applications.
- GPU (Graphics Processing Unit): Also known as the graphics card, this handles all the visual processing, crucial for smooth gaming.
- Motherboard: The central hub that connects all the components.
- RAM (Random Access Memory): Short-term memory used for actively running applications and games.
- Storage (SSD/HDD): Where your operating system, games, and files are stored.
- Power Supply (PSU): Provides power to all the components.
- Case: Encloses and protects all the components.
- CPU Cooler: Dissipates heat from the CPU to prevent overheating.
Component Breakdown and Budget-Friendly Recommendations
CPU: AMD Ryzen 5 5600 or Intel Core i5-12400F
For under $1000, the AMD Ryzen 5 5600 and the Intel Core i5-12400F are excellent choices. They offer a great balance of performance and price, capable of handling most modern games at high settings. The Ryzen 5 5600 often comes at a slightly lower price point, while the i5-12400F sometimes offers slightly better single-core performance, beneficial for some games. Check current prices to make the best decision.
Estimated Cost: $130 - $170
GPU: AMD Radeon RX 6600 or NVIDIA GeForce RTX 3050
The graphics card is arguably the most important component for gaming. The AMD Radeon RX 6600 and NVIDIA GeForce RTX 3050 are solid options for 1080p gaming at high settings. These cards provide a good balance between performance and affordability. Monitor prices closely, as they can fluctuate. Look for sales or used options in good condition to save money.
Estimated Cost: $200 - $250
Motherboard: Budget-Friendly Options for AMD and Intel
For the Ryzen 5 5600, look for a B450 or B550 motherboard. For the Intel Core i5-12400F, an H610 or B660 motherboard will suffice. These chipsets offer a good balance of features and affordability. Ensure the motherboard is compatible with your chosen CPU socket (AM4 for Ryzen 5 5600, LGA 1700 for i5-12400F).
Estimated Cost: $70 - $100
RAM: 16GB DDR4 3200MHz
16GB of RAM is the sweet spot for modern gaming. Aim for DDR4 3200MHz or faster for optimal performance. You can often find affordable kits from reputable brands like Corsair, G.Skill, or Crucial. Make sure your motherboard supports the RAM speed you choose.
Estimated Cost: $40 - $60
Storage: 1TB NVMe SSD
An NVMe SSD (Solid State Drive) will significantly improve loading times and overall system responsiveness compared to a traditional hard drive. A 1TB NVMe SSD provides ample storage for your operating system, games, and applications. Consider adding a larger HDD later for additional storage if needed.
Estimated Cost: $50 - $80
Power Supply (PSU): 550W 80+ Bronze Certified
A reliable power supply is crucial for ensuring stable performance and protecting your components. A 550W 80+ Bronze certified PSU should be sufficient for this build. Brands like Corsair, EVGA, and Seasonic offer reliable options. Check reviews before purchasing to ensure quality.
Estimated Cost: $40 - $60
Case: Budget-Friendly ATX Mid-Tower
The case is primarily for aesthetics and protecting your components. A budget-friendly ATX mid-tower case will provide enough space and airflow for your build. Look for cases with good ventilation and cable management features. Popular options include cases from Cooler Master, Corsair, and NZXT.
Estimated Cost: $40 - $60
CPU Cooler: Stock Cooler or Budget Aftermarket Cooler
The stock cooler that comes with the Ryzen 5 5600 or Intel Core i5-12400F is usually sufficient for stock speeds. However, if you plan to overclock or live in a hot environment, consider a budget-friendly aftermarket cooler like the Cooler Master Hyper 212 or the be quiet! Pure Rock 2. These coolers offer better cooling performance and lower noise levels.
Estimated Cost: $20 - $40 (if purchasing aftermarket)
Tips for Saving Money
Look for Sales and Discounts
Keep an eye out for sales and discounts on PC components. Websites like Newegg, Amazon, and Micro Center often have deals on various parts. Black Friday and Cyber Monday are excellent opportunities to save money.
Consider Used Components
Buying used components, such as the graphics card or RAM, can save you a significant amount of money. However, be cautious and only purchase from reputable sellers with good feedback. Always test the components thoroughly before committing to the purchase.
Buy in Bundles
Some retailers offer bundles that include the CPU, motherboard, and RAM at a discounted price. These bundles can save you money compared to buying the components separately.
Don't Overspend on Aesthetics
While RGB lighting and fancy cases can look cool, they add to the cost of your build. If you're on a tight budget, prioritize performance over aesthetics.
Building Your PC: A Step-by-Step Guide (Brief Overview)
Building a PC can seem daunting, but it's a rewarding experience. Here's a brief overview of the steps involved:
- Prepare Your Workspace: Ensure you have a clean, well-lit workspace with plenty of room to maneuver.
- Install the CPU on the Motherboard: Carefully align the CPU with the socket on the motherboard and gently seat it in place.
- Install the RAM: Insert the RAM modules into the appropriate slots on the motherboard, ensuring they click into place.
- Mount the Motherboard in the Case: Secure the motherboard to the case using screws.
- Install the GPU: Insert the graphics card into the PCIe slot on the motherboard.
- Install the Storage Devices: Connect the SSD to the motherboard using the appropriate cables.
- Connect the Power Supply: Connect the power supply cables to the motherboard, graphics card, and storage devices.
- Install the CPU Cooler: Install the CPU cooler on top of the CPU.
- Cable Management: Neatly organize the cables to improve airflow and aesthetics.
- Install the Operating System: Install your operating system (Windows, Linux) from a USB drive or disc.
Numerous online resources, including YouTube videos and detailed guides, can provide step-by-step instructions for building a PC. Take your time, follow the instructions carefully, and don't be afraid to ask for help if you get stuck.
